**Ticket: ORM-118 — expired credentials blocking refactor validation**

The Quillbase ORM refactor branch cannot run its integration suite because the credential used to reach the Dataspine schema service expired over the weekend. This blocks the comparison tests between the legacy mapper and the new repository layer, which are required before the cut. A replacement credential has been issued and validated against staging. The new key for Dataspine follows.

service key, fawip-bajef: kto11_Qt5wZK9vdNC

## Build Provenance — EchoDocent Audio Guide

Hey plugin authors! Every EchoDocent release ships with a provenance record so you can verify which core build your plugin was tested against. We generate it on the Bramblefort build farm at package time, and it never changes after signing. Before publishing a plugin, confirm your manifest references a real token. The current release token appears just below.

pipeline stamp: htk9_ce63042d9

## Introduce per-tenant rate quotas in the Orvane gateway

For the release manager: this change replaces our global throttle with per-tenant quotas, resolved at request time from the tenant registry and cached for sixty seconds. Tenants without an explicit quota inherit the tier default; overage returns a retryable status with a hint header. Rollout is gated behind a flag, defaulting off, and the old throttle remains as a backstop until two clean release cycles pass.

The initial tier defaults we intend to ship are listed below.

limits module of taguf-hafog:
WEIGHTS = {
    "wenox": 690,
    "wenok": 782,
    "kelax": 41,
    "holox": 338,
    "quenir": 39,
}

The loading dock at Harwick Court accepts deliveries Monday to Friday, 07:30–15:00. Outside these hours, drivers should be redirected to the main entrance, where reception signs for small parcels only. Large or palletised deliveries must be rebooked through the facilities calendar. If a scheduled delivery arrives and no dock staff are present, reception may open the roller door themselves using the dock-side keypad. Enter the current pass code shown below.

turnstile pass: bdg-NZJSS-18109